Rustic Schoolhouse Stay by the Cumberland River
Step back in time with a stay at this charming old schoolhouse turned country getaway. Simple, cozy, and full of character, this unique spot offers a rustic retreat where you can unplug and enjoy the beauty of southern Kentucky.
🌿 Nature & Outdoors
Just a quarter-mile from the Cumberland River and a public boat ramp, you’ll have easy access for fishing, boating, and exploring the water. A short walk will take you right to the riverbank—perfect for casting a line or simply soaking in the peaceful views.
🍳 Local Charm
An old country store nearby serves up hearty weekend breakfasts, home-style lunches, and hand-scooped ice cream. Just minutes away, you’ll also find the Natural Rock Bridge, a local hidden gem and a must-see for hikers and photographers alike.
🚤 Adventures Await
25 minutes to Wolf Creek Dam and Lake Cumberland State Park
Explore the vast waters of Lake Cumberland—a boating and fishing paradise
Relax in small-town Kentucky charm, while still being close to outdoor adventure
🛏️ Your Stay
The schoolhouse is modest but comfortable—think rustic simplicity rather than luxury. It’s a great spot for fishermen, explorers, or anyone looking for a laid-back place to rest after a day on the water.
